Sinopsis

An untold American frontier story … 
North Dakota, 1905  
After fleeing persecution in the Russian Empire, eleven-year-old Shoshana and her  
family, Jewish immigrants, start a new life on the prairie. Shoshana takes fierce joy  
in the wild beauty of the plains and the thrill of forging a new, American identity.  
But it’s not as simple for her older sister, Libke, who misses their Ukrainian village  
and doesn’t learn English as quickly or make friends as easily.  
Desperate to fit in, Shoshana finds herself hiding her Jewish identity in the face of  
prejudice, just as Libke insists they preserve it. For the first time, Shoshana is at  
odds with her beloved sister, and has to look deep inside herself to realize that  
her family’s difference is their greatest strength. By listening to the music that’s  
lived in her heart all along, Shoshana finds new meaning in the Jewish expression  
all beginnings are difficult, as well as in the resilience and traditions her people  
have brought all the way to the North Dakota prairie.
